My husband and I are on our first day of Keto. He has been amazing supporting me through every dad diet under the sun until I just gave up a couple of years ago. Finally we realized we needed a change and this time we did the research together. While he works from home mostly (making cooking etc easier) I work in the community, often working doubles and constantly on the run (which has contributed to my weight gain as I have always seen fast food as an easy supplement to a nutritional meal). Here is my question, and the thing that I worry will get in my way: What are some good snacks, meals or tips for eating on the run that I wouldn't need to refrigerate? As much as I would love to drive a refrigerator van, my little Sunfire will have to do for now!
